日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!

一、開發(fā)APP軟件所需的編程語言和開發(fā)環(huán)境概述

想要開發(fā)APP軟件,首先得明確目標(biāo)平臺,是蘋果iOS還是安卓Android。不同的平臺,自然需要不同的編程語言和開發(fā)環(huán)境。

安卓開發(fā)

對于Android平臺,開發(fā)環(huán)境可以在Windows上搭建。開發(fā)者通常會選擇安裝Android Studio這一開發(fā)工具,而背后的編程語言主要是Java。雖然Java是安卓開發(fā)的基礎(chǔ),但隨著技術(shù)的演進(jìn),也有其他語言如Kotlin開始涉足這一領(lǐng)域。

iOS開發(fā)

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!
相較之下,iOS的開發(fā)則更依賴于蘋果Mac系統(tǒng)。開發(fā)者需要在Mac系統(tǒng)下使用Xcode這一開發(fā)工具。早期的iOS開發(fā)主要使用Objective-C,但如今,Swift已成為主流編程語言。

二、Visual Basic:是編程語言還是開發(fā)環(huán)境?

Visual Basic被歸類為可視化編程語言,它允許開發(fā)者通過拖拽控件等方式進(jìn)行開發(fā),使得開發(fā)過程更為直觀。Visual Basic依托于諸如Visual Basic 2005之類的開發(fā)工具存在,這些工具為開發(fā)者提供了一個(gè)集成化的開發(fā)環(huán)境。 值得注意的是,編程語言和開發(fā)環(huán)境是兩個(gè)不同的概念。編程語言是交流的工具,而開發(fā)環(huán)境則是這個(gè)工具存在的場所。 以漢語為例,它是人們交流的語言。而人的身體、大腦和思想則相當(dāng)于開發(fā)環(huán)境,只有具備了這些,才能“說出”漢語。

三、編程語言和開發(fā)平臺的區(qū)別

在軟件開發(fā)領(lǐng)域,編程語言和開發(fā)平臺是兩個(gè)重要的組成部分。編程語言是編寫代碼的工具,如Java、C++等。而開發(fā)平臺則提供了集成化的開發(fā)環(huán)境,如Visual Studio、Eclipse等。 對于初學(xué)者來說,Java是一個(gè)不錯(cuò)的選擇。而對于開發(fā)平臺,如VS2005,它支持多種語言,并為開發(fā)者提供了豐富的功能。

四、適合大型軟件開發(fā)的編程語言和開發(fā)環(huán)境

對于大型軟件的開發(fā),C++ Builder是一個(gè)不錯(cuò)的選擇。這款由Borland公司出品的工具操作簡單,能夠高效地幫助開發(fā)者完成大型軟件的開發(fā)。

五、關(guān)于與OpenGL配合較好的編程語言和開發(fā)環(huán)境

一、C++編譯器與OpenGL開發(fā)

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!

一般的C++編譯器都能夠勝任OpenGL開發(fā)工作。新版本的編譯器更加穩(wěn)定高效。在進(jìn)行OpenGL開發(fā)之前,需要設(shè)置一些參數(shù)。這些參數(shù)的設(shè)置并不復(fù)雜,只需要熟悉Visual Studio 2010界面的朋友稍微指導(dǎo)一下,就能輕松掌握。

二、app開發(fā)概述

泛娛科技app的開發(fā)涵蓋了多個(gè)方面。我們需要確定app應(yīng)用所在的行業(yè)及其特點(diǎn),以便更好地定位開發(fā)方向。我們需要制定開發(fā)的方案和計(jì)劃,確定針對行業(yè)的具體應(yīng)用方向。開發(fā)所需的軟件環(huán)境、開發(fā)語言的選擇以及成本節(jié)約的策略都是我們需要考慮的內(nèi)容。我們致力于提供良好的用戶體驗(yàn),包括應(yīng)用軟件部分、后臺服務(wù)程序部分以及人機(jī)交互部分的界面體驗(yàn)。維護(hù)以及版本的升級管理也是app開發(fā)不可或缺的一部分。

三、APP開發(fā)流程之用戶需求分析

用戶需求分析是APP開發(fā)流程中最重要的一環(huán)。這一步需要梳理用戶對APP的功能需求,并基于這些需求進(jìn)行整理、分類和排序,形成功能結(jié)構(gòu)模塊。這個(gè)過程需要與客戶緊密溝通,確保理解并滿足客戶的實(shí)際需求,從而為APP的成功奠定堅(jiān)實(shí)的基礎(chǔ)。

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!

四、APP開發(fā)流程之產(chǎn)品設(shè)計(jì)

在完成用戶需求分析之后,我們進(jìn)入產(chǎn)品原型設(shè)計(jì)階段。在這個(gè)階段,我們會利用現(xiàn)有的功能模塊搭建一個(gè)簡單的產(chǎn)品原型,展示基本的功能結(jié)構(gòu)給客戶。通過產(chǎn)品原型設(shè)計(jì)軟件,我們可以模擬出相似的APP產(chǎn)品,與客戶確認(rèn)后,即可進(jìn)入下一階段的開發(fā)。

五、APP開發(fā)的技術(shù)細(xì)節(jié)

在APP開發(fā)過程中,技術(shù)細(xì)節(jié)至關(guān)重要。UI視覺設(shè)計(jì)階段,設(shè)計(jì)師們會根據(jù)APP的表現(xiàn)內(nèi)容進(jìn)行版面設(shè)計(jì),進(jìn)行配色和頁面元素的設(shè)計(jì),最終呈現(xiàn)出吸引人的APP界面效果圖。數(shù)據(jù)庫搭建、服務(wù)端開發(fā)和iOS/Android客戶端開發(fā)也是不可或缺的部分。服務(wù)端是APP應(yīng)用的核心處理過程所在,而客戶端的APP則主要負(fù)責(zé)收發(fā)數(shù)據(jù)。為了滿足不同設(shè)備的需求,我們會對Android和iOS的設(shè)備進(jìn)行針對性的開發(fā)和優(yōu)化。整個(gè)開發(fā)過程注重?cái)?shù)據(jù)的處理效率、安全性和穩(wěn)定性,以確保用戶在使用APP時(shí)獲得良好的體驗(yàn)。APP開發(fā)全流程解析

一、需求收集與功能規(guī)劃

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!

在APP開發(fā)的起點(diǎn),我們首先要深入了解客戶的需求與期望。與客戶充分溝通,收集關(guān)于APP的各項(xiàng)功能需求,制定一個(gè)明確的功能規(guī)劃。這一階段是確保APP最終能滿足用戶需求的基石。

二、設(shè)計(jì)與原型開發(fā)

在明確功能需求后,進(jìn)入設(shè)計(jì)與原型開發(fā)階段。設(shè)計(jì)團(tuán)隊(duì)會根據(jù)用戶需求,繪制出APP的界面設(shè)計(jì),創(chuàng)建一個(gè)直觀的原型,確保開發(fā)者、設(shè)計(jì)師和客戶都對項(xiàng)目的方向有一致的理解。

三、APP程序開發(fā)

此階段是整個(gè)項(xiàng)目中的核心部分。根據(jù)設(shè)計(jì)和原型,開發(fā)團(tuán)隊(duì)開始編寫代碼,實(shí)現(xiàn)各項(xiàng)功能。這個(gè)過程需要精細(xì)的工作和嚴(yán)格的要求,確保每一行代碼的穩(wěn)定性和效率。

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!

四、測試與修復(fù)

完成初步開發(fā)后,進(jìn)入關(guān)鍵的測試階段。對APP客戶端進(jìn)行全面測試,模擬用戶正常使用以及非正常使用的情況。測試人員會導(dǎo)入測試數(shù)據(jù),對APP進(jìn)行全面檢查,記錄測試結(jié)果。如果出現(xiàn)錯(cuò)誤,將返回到開發(fā)階段進(jìn)行修復(fù)。只有當(dāng)測試通過,才說明整體APP開發(fā)過程已經(jīng)完成。接下來,將成品APP交給用戶進(jìn)行試用,只有在用戶滿意后,才會進(jìn)入下一個(gè)階段。

五、發(fā)布與維護(hù)

完成簽名驗(yàn)證后,APP開發(fā)進(jìn)入最后一個(gè)階段——發(fā)布階段。將開發(fā)好的客戶端APP程序提交到各大應(yīng)用商店,如iOS版本的APP提交到蘋果的AppStore,安卓版則提交到國內(nèi)各大安卓應(yīng)用商店。上線后,對APP進(jìn)行維護(hù),收集用戶反饋信息,及時(shí)修復(fù)出現(xiàn)的錯(cuò)誤(Bug)。如果客戶需要進(jìn)行功能更新,開發(fā)團(tuán)隊(duì)會根據(jù)需求進(jìn)行更新開發(fā),經(jīng)過測試通過后發(fā)布新版本。

注意事項(xiàng):

【揭秘】2025年APP開發(fā)必備環(huán)境及軟件工具全解析!

從最初的客戶需求收集到最終的測試上線,一個(gè)完整的APP開發(fā)流程需要高度重視用戶需求。只有緊扣用戶需求,才能確保開發(fā)出質(zhì)量上乘、用戶認(rèn)可的APP軟件。這是每個(gè)APP開發(fā)企業(yè)都必須牢記的原則。在開發(fā)過程中,任何一個(gè)環(huán)節(jié)的疏忽都可能導(dǎo)致最終產(chǎn)品的質(zhì)量和用戶體驗(yàn)受到影響。細(xì)心、嚴(yán)謹(jǐn)、創(chuàng)新和對用戶需求的深入理解是打造優(yōu)秀APP的關(guān)鍵。


本文原地址:http://m.czyjwy.com/news/38448.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:【揭秘】2025年APP開發(fā)必備技術(shù):主流框架與工具一網(wǎng)打盡
下一篇:【2025年最熱】開發(fā)APP必備語言指南:選擇哪種語言最佳?